How to Choose the Right Server Management Software for Your Business?

Selecting the right server management software is crucial for any business aiming to maintain efficient IT operations. In a world where servers are at the heart of almost every business system, having the right management tools in place can improve efficiency, security, and productivity. The decision of which software to choose can have long-term effects on the organization, so it must be done carefully, taking various factors into account.

Understanding Your Business Needs

The first step in choosing the right server management software is understanding your business’s unique requirements. Different industries and company sizes will have varying server needs. For example, a small business with limited IT infrastructure will require different capabilities than a large enterprise managing multiple data centers or virtual servers. Some companies might prioritize features like automation and real-time monitoring, while others may focus on customization and scalability. Understanding the specifics of your business will guide you toward the software that aligns with your goals.

Compatibility with Your Existing Infrastructure

Server management software must be compatible with your existing infrastructure, which includes both hardware and software systems. If your servers operate on a specific operating system or you use particular types of hardware, it is essential to choose management software that can integrate seamlessly with these components. Compatibility ensures smooth operations and minimizes the need for extensive adjustments or additional investments. Incompatibility can lead to inefficient management and cause performance bottlenecks, undermining your overall operations.

Scalability and Flexibility for Future Growth

As your business grows, so too will its server management needs. Therefore, it is critical to choose server management software that is scalable. Scalability allows the software to grow with your business, providing support for additional servers, networks, or more complex infrastructure. Flexibility also plays a key role; it enables your IT team to adjust configurations or add features as needed without a complete system overhaul. A flexible and scalable system ensures your business can adapt to technological advancements and evolving demands.

Security Features for Protecting Your Data

Server security should be a top priority when choosing top server management software. With cyberattacks becoming more frequent and sophisticated, businesses must ensure their data is protected at all times. The server management software you choose should offer robust security features such as encryption, access control, regular updates, and patch management. It should also provide continuous monitoring to detect and prevent potential security threats. By incorporating advanced security measures, you minimize vulnerabilities and safeguard sensitive company data.

Ease of Use and Automation

Ease of use is another important consideration. Your IT team should be able to manage servers without unnecessary complications. A user-friendly interface and easy-to-understand features ensure that your team can manage server performance, security, and uptime more efficiently. Moreover, automation capabilities in server management software can significantly reduce manual workload. Automation tools help in repetitive tasks like backups, monitoring, and patching, freeing up your IT staff to focus on more strategic initiatives.

Cost and Budgetary Considerations

Budget is always a key factor in choosing any business software. When considering server management tools, it’s essential to balance cost with the features and support your business requires. There are both open-source and premium software solutions available, each with its own set of advantages and disadvantages. Open-source tools may offer cost savings, but they might lack comprehensive support. Premium solutions, on the other hand, often come with higher upfront costs but include dedicated customer support and advanced features that can justify the expense over time.

Vendor Support and Reliability

Finally, the reliability of the software provider is critical. Ensure that the vendor offers comprehensive support, both during the installation process and for ongoing maintenance and troubleshooting. A reliable support team will provide timely solutions in case of issues and help you maintain the software efficiently. Look for reviews, customer testimonials, and case studies to evaluate the vendor’s reputation and reliability. Reliable vendors also tend to offer regular software updates that keep the system secure and up-to-date with the latest technological advances.
